Maison  >  Article  >  interface Web  >  Comment puis-je personnaliser les fenêtres contextuelles de validation de formulaire HTML5 ?

Comment puis-je personnaliser les fenêtres contextuelles de validation de formulaire HTML5 ?

Linda Hamilton
Linda Hamiltonoriginal
2024-11-08 11:24:01176parcourir

How Can I Customize HTML5 Form Validation Popups?

Personnalisation des fenêtres contextuelles de validation de formulaire HTML5

Lors de l'utilisation de formulaires HTML5, les fenêtres contextuelles de validation par défaut peuvent parfois être insatisfaisantes. Cependant, il est crucial de noter qu'il est impossible de modifier le style de validation en utilisant uniquement HTML et CSS.

La fenêtre contextuelle par défaut fait partie intégrante du navigateur lui-même. Le seul attribut que vous pouvez modifier est le message d'erreur, qui peut être défini à l'aide de :

document.getElementById("name").setCustomValidity("Lorum Ipsum");

Pour une solution alternative, envisagez d'utiliser jQuery. La bibliothèque Webshims (https://github.com/jquery/webshim) fournit une méthode pour remplacer le style du panneau via CSS.

Cette approche ingénieuse vous permet de personnaliser l'interface utilisateur du panneau d'erreur, comme le montre cet exemple. : http://jsfiddle.net/trixta/qTV3g/.

Bien qu'il ne s'agisse pas d'un plugin, cette approche utilise une bibliothèque DOM pour fournir une solution complète pour modifier les fenêtres contextuelles d'erreur par défaut. Il représente la manière la plus efficace et la plus élégante de réaliser cette personnalisation.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n